Board Exams: More Than Just Marks

Board exams—two words that bring a mix of stress, late-night cramming, and a whole lot of pressure. For months, students juggle textbooks, revision schedules, and expectations from parents and teachers. It feels like everything depends on a few hours in an exam hall.

But do these exams truly measure intelligence? Or just how well we memorize and manage stress? While good scores open doors, they don’t define a person’s potential. Learning should be about curiosity and understanding, not just passing a test.

So, if you’re facing board exams, give it your best shot—but remember, they’re just one chapter in a much bigger story.
